How can I delete the yellow pages and ATT Navigator on my bold? I tried going to options---->Applications but they do not show up!

You don't. They are both pushed via your service books. Even if
you delete them they will return when you reset or resend your
service books.
Best thing to do is create a folder called "trash" or something, move
the icons to it and then hide the folder. Out of site, out of mind.
